What will you do?

Duties and responsibilities of a Disability Support Worker are unique and varied because those we support have unique needs. You could be working in people's homes and/or in the community.

Community Access involves supporting participants to engage in activities outside their home, helping them build independence, social connections, and life skills.

In this role, you will:

Accompany participants to community activities such as social outings, appointments, shopping, education, or recreational programs

Support participants to develop confidence and independence in everyday tasks

Encourage social interaction and inclusion within the community





Assist with transport and ensure participants’ safety and wellbeing during outings

Domestic assistance involves supporting participants to maintain a clean, safe, and comfortable home environment while promoting independence and daily living skills.

In this role you will:

Assist with general household tasks such as cleaning, vacuuming, mopping, dusting, and laundry

Support meal preparation and basic food safety practices

Help with grocery shopping and household organization

Encourage participants to develop and maintain independent living skills

Follow individual support plans and respect each participant’s routines, preferences, and cultural background

Maintain a safe and hygienic living environment
